Key Responsibilities:
- Perform inpatient facility coding including ICD-10-CM, ICD-10-PCS, CPT/HCPCS, DRG, and E&M for all encounters assigned.
- Access and review health record documentation in VA's VistA/CPRS system and enter codes into the approved coding application.
- Apply modifiers, CCI bundling guidelines, and Reason Not Billable designations as appropriate.
Minimum Qualifications:
- Active coding credential from AHIMA (RHIA, RHIT, CCS, or CCS-P) or AAPC (CPC or CPC-H).
- Minimum 2 years of experience in inpatient coding and proficiency with ICD-10-CM, ICD-10-PCS, CPT/HCPCS, DRG, and E&M guidelines.
- Ability to work within VA systems and comply with HIPAA/VA directives.
